Customer:
The client is a leading provider of enterprise scale Financial Management System. The project was about stabilizing a modular, completely integrated suite of software applications in this domain. The project scope included application sustenance involving defect fixes for critical business issues as well as a proposed enhancement aimed at allowing external applications to access the system’s functionality.
The Challenge:
The client was looking for an off-site team, which would work as an extension of its own team and work closely with their internal IT team. The requirement was for a team well versed in the technology development methodologies and capable of rapid ramp up in the specific domain.
The Solution:
- Sopra India created an offshore development center staffed witha team of highly skilled professionals with expertise on application domain and technology, including extensive experience in ANSI COBOL and AcuCorp Extend family product.
- The project devised a formalized method and phase of carrying out Knowledge Transfer that included activities like mail-based discussions, telephone conferences and walk through sessions and client team visits.
- Elimination of multiple iterations on same task through customized instruments such as limited scope impact analysis report for critical defects for early verification by client.
- The team devised certain instruments to ensure accurate and prompt tracking of multiple tasks to ensure that nothing falls through the cracks in the hectic project life cycle.
Technology Used:
- AcuCobol, AcuCorp extend family product
- Wang VS Cobol
- Netron CAP framework, WISP
- Oracle database
- Java
- The runtime environment of the system was AcuCobol GT and Oracle database. AcuCorp Acu4GL is used to access Oracle database.
